#356cfe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#356cfe is composed of 20.8% red, 42.4% green and 99.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 79.1% cyan, 57.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 0.4% black. It has a hue angle of 223.6 degrees, a saturation of 99% and a lightness of 60.2%. #356cfe color hex could be obtained by blending #6ad8ff with #0000fd. Closest websafe color is: #3366ff.

Shades and Tints of #356cfe
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#00040d is the darkest color, while #f8faff is the lightest one.

Tones of #356cfe
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#9396a0 is the less saturated color, while #356cfe is the most saturated one.
